Background technology
Washing machine is a kind of equipment for removing spot on clothing using the chemical action and inner cylinder of detergent or the mechanical movement of impeller.The level of regulation washing machine is major issue when installing washing machine, if washing machine does not have leveling, the outer barrel of washing machine easily collides with casing in laundry processes, or even the overall strenuous vibration on the ground of washing machine, various noises can be not only sent, and long-time is damaged using washing machine is easily caused.And the uneven caused vibrations of washing machine may loosen foot-screw, this unstability may change the horizontality of washing machine, cause to produce stronger vibrations;Causing the noise of washing machine can become increasing.
Washing machine includes casing and is located at four footing that bottom of shell is used to support washing machine, footing is divided into fixed footing and adjustable bottom feet, it is general to set adjustable bottom feet to be one or two, the level of washing machine is adjusted by adjusting adjustable bottom feet, adjustable bottom feet includes the base contacted with ground and the threaded post being located on base, the screw matched with threaded post is provided with the bottom of casing, spacing between the bottom surface of casing and ground is adjusted by the rotation of threaded post, holding level of washing machine is reached and is grounded stable purpose.Due to the heavier-weight of washing machine, in leveling, there is larger frictional force between the base of footing and ground so that this leveling needs to apply larger moment of torsion and adjustment troublesome poeration;And levelling effect is general, simply basis is artificial judges adjustment balance, that is, is not rocked with hand applying power washer cabinet, but possible washing machine is not on horizontality.In addition, washing machine is typically placed on toilet or balcony, it is contemplated that draining facilitates problem, the ground of toilet or balcony is typically designed as the ground with certain slope, and which in turns increases the difficulty that washing machine adjusts level.

Refering to Fig. 1-Fig. 6, it is one embodiment of the self-level(l)ing device of washing machine proposed by the invention, washing machine includes casing 10, casing 10 has bottom plate 101, provided with four footing 1 on bottom plate 101, at least one footing is set to the self-level(l)ing device 20 in the present embodiment, passes through the adjustment of self-level(l)ing device 20, ensure that washing machine is in horizontality, precondition is provided for the smooth working of washing machine.
In the present embodiment, referring to shown in Fig. 1-Fig. 3, self-level(l)ing device 20 includes footing 1, accepts part 2, interior threaded part 3 and drive device 4, wherein, footing 1 has the base 11 contacted with ground and sets threaded rod 12 on the pedestal 11;Accept part 2 there is the outer ring portion 21 fixed with the casing 10 of washing machine and be sleeved on the inner side of outer ring portion 21 and with outer ring portion 21 can relative circumferential movement inner ring portion 22, inner ring portion 22 and outer ring portion 21 are coaxially disposed;Interior threaded part 3 matches and screwed on threaded rod 12 with threaded rod 12, and interior threaded part 3 is fixed with inner ring portion 22;Drive device 4 is used to drive interior threaded part 3 to move on threaded rod 12.
Specifically, the driving interior threaded part 3 of drive device 4 rotates so that interior threaded part 3 is moved up or down while being rotated around threaded rod 12;Inner ring portion 22 and interior threaded part 3 are fixed, and inner ring portion 22 of inner ring portion 22 follows interior threaded part 3 to rotate and move up or down, while inner ring portion 22 rotates in a circumferential direction motion also relative to outer ring portion 21;Outer ring portion 21 has movement up or down under the drive in inner ring portion 22, outer ring portion 21 is fixed on bottom plate 101, namely so that the bottom plate 101 at outer ring portion 21 is moved up or down, also allow for footing 1 and there occurs relative move up or down relative to the bottom plate 101 of casing 10, or perhaps bottom plate 101 there occurs movement up or down relative to base 11, it is achieved thereby that for the purpose of washing machine leveling.
In the present embodiment, the outer ring portion 21 for accepting part 2 is fixed on the bottom plate 101 of casing 10, inner ring portion 22 is fixed with interior threaded part 3, and inner ring portion 22 and outer ring portion 21 can relative circumferential movement, interior threaded part 3 is threadedly coupled with threaded rod 12.So by set accept that part 2 to only need to when adjusting footing 1 to adjust upper-lower position of the interior threaded part 3 on threaded rod 12 can;And accept part 2 by setting so that self-level(l)ing device is simple in construction, easy to adjust, avoid the trouble manually adjusted and greatly reduce the driving force that regulation needs.Interior threaded part 3 is driven to rotate by drive device 4, so that interior threaded part 3 is moved up or down on threaded rod 12, inner ring portion 22 follows interior threaded part 3 to move and rotated in a circumferential direction relative to outer ring portion 21 together, so as to realize that footing 1, in the adjustment of above-below direction, adjusts washing machine and be in horizontality relative to casing 10.
Certainly, outer ring portion 21 is geo-stationary in the axial direction with inner ring portion 22, that is, outer ring portion 21 can only be around axis relative rotary motion with inner ring portion 22.In order to reduce the resistance of relative rotary motion between outer ring portion 21 and inner ring portion 22 frictional force in other words, accepting part 2 also has the rolled portion 23 being located between outer ring portion 21 and inner ring portion 22, the neck 24 of annular is namely formed between outer ring portion 21 and inner ring portion 22, rolled portion 23 is located in neck 24, so that being rolling friction between outer ring portion 21 and inner ring portion 22, so that less moment of torsion can just drive interior threaded part to rotate, the driving force needed is smaller, allow the size of driving part 4 smaller, be conducive to arrangement of the drive device 4 in casing 1.Pass through the structure setting between outer ring portion 21, inner ring portion 22 and rolled portion 23 so that axial power can be born by accepting part 2, and outer ring portion 21 is geo-stationary in the axial direction with inner ring portion 22.It is preferred that, neck 24 is pyramidal structure, is gradually reduced from the top down for the distance apart from axis, so that larger axial force can be born by accepting part 2.
It is shown in Figure 4, rolled portion 23 is included along neck 24 circumferentially distributed multiple rolling elements 231 and retainer 232, retainer 232 is used for rolling element 231 is equally spaced and be distributed on the circumference of neck 24, to prevent from colliding with each other between rolling element 231 during work, and guide the rolling of rolling element 231.In order to further increase the stress performance for accepting the axial direction of part 2, it is cone, reduced diameter from top to bottom to set rolling element 231.
In the present embodiment, drive device 4 includes motor 41, the driving wheel 42 being connected with motor 41 and the driven pulley 43 engaged with driving wheel 42, wherein, driven pulley 43 is fixed with interior threaded part 3, sets the axis of driven pulley 43 to be overlapped with the axis of interior threaded part 3.The moment of torsion that namely motor 41 is exported, is forwarded to driven pulley 43, and drive the rotary motion of interior threaded part 3 by driving wheel 42.
Certainly, in other embodiments, driven pulley 43 can also be set to be fixed with inner ring portion 22, because inner ring portion 22 is fixed with interior threaded part 3, namely driven pulley 43, inner ring portion 22 and the three of interior threaded part 3 are integrally fixed at together, three can be that three parts of a global facility or three separated parts are fixed together.
In the present embodiment, threaded rod 12, interior threaded part 3, inner ring portion 22, outer ring portion 21, driven pulley 43 are all coaxially disposed.
The vibrations in fastness and reduction washing process in order to increase footing 1, one layer of rubber layer 13 is coated with the outside of base 11.
Installation for self-level(l)ing device 20 is fixed, and mounting hole is offered on the bottom plate of casing 10, and outer ring portion 21 is fixed at mounting hole, now, and threaded rod 12 passes through mounting hole, and motor 41 is fixed on the bottom plate 101 in casing 10.
In order to detect whether washing machine is in horizontality, the sensor for being used for detecting washing machine water level state is provided with washing machine, washing machine is according to the signal of sensor feedback, the control action adjustment level of washing machine of self-level(l)ing device 20.So pass through the adjustment of self-level(l)ing device 20 so that washing machine is in horizontality, be conducive to increasing the stabilization in washing process, reduce vibrations, the service life of increase washing machine.
Pressure sensor or inclination sensor can be set for sensor, the level condition for detecting washing machine.The signal of detection is fed back to main control by sensor, and provided with leveling button or leveling option on the control panel of washing machine.
It is the control flow chart of the method for automatically leveling of washing machine in the present embodiment referring to Fig. 6, leveling method comprises the steps:
A, startup levelling function.
B, sensor detect the horizontality of washing machine, and testing result is fed back into main controller.
C, main controller judge whether washing machine is in horizontality according to the testing result of feedback, and in this way, then leveling terminates;If not, into step D.
Specifically, such as with a pressure sensor, then main controller compares the pressure value of feedback with the pressure value set, judge washing machine whether level.The pressure value of setting is usually a quarter of washer weight.
Certainly, in order to further increase the accuracy of detection, pressure sensor can be all set in four footing 1 of washing machine, main controller compares the testing result of receive four feedbacks, it is possible to judge washing machine whether level.When washing machine water usually, the pressure that four footing are subject to should be equal.
It is of course also possible to set inclination sensor, main controller according to the feedback result received can easily judge washing machine whether level.
D, main controller determine whether that self-level(l)ing device 20 needs to heighten or turn down according to testing result, and give the signal of the forward or reverse of drive device 4, and drive device 4 is acted.
Specifically, drive device 4 is acted, it is possible to drive interior threaded part 3 to drive inner ring portion 22 to rotate and moved up on threaded rod 12 together.
In the present embodiment, drive device 4 includes stepper motor, the pulse number that main controller determines to need the height of adjustment and calculate needs according to the testing result of feedback.Stepper motor is given by the umber of pulse calculated, controlled motor rotates a certain angle, and then drive interior threaded part 3 to rotate a certain angle, interior threaded part 3 moves up or down a certain distance on threaded rod 12, realizes the adjustment of footing 2.
E, repeat step B are to D, until leveling terminates so that washing machine is in horizontality.
